AXEL

I come across Emily just as she tosses the rabbit carcass aside.

A few times when she’s run off on me, I’ve scented traces of blood and assumed she’d been hunting.

The hunting instincts vary from wolf to wolf.

Some have very strong compulsions and regularly shift into wolf form to hunt. Some will even hunt in human form. I’d heard

Tobin was one such wolf.

Others, the compulsion isn’t as strong, so maybe they only hunt under a full moon.

As I watch Emily step over to the river to wash the blood from her hands and mouth, I wonder if she’s always had a high hunter drive, or if this is a new development since her captivity.

I can’t say whether she hunted in human form just now, or whether she had done so in wolf form like usual and had just shifted back when I came upon her.

It probably doesn’t matter in the scheme of things, but if it starts looking like it might be causing issues or getting out of hand,

then I might have to consider talking to Aaron about it.

one more thing about Emily I’ll have to monitor closely.

I can also pick up the quickly dispersing scent of some kind of male.

It’s weak, so I can’t tell if it was another wolf or human.

We’re not far from the public hiking trails the humans use around these parts, so there’s every possibility it was just someone passing by, and they had no interaction with Emily whatsoever.
